Solutions:<\/strong><\/span><\/p>\n<p><strong>1)\u00a0Answer\u00a0(B)<\/strong><\/p>\n<p>$6p^2+5p+1 = 0$<br \/>\n$(2p+1)(3p+1) = 0$<br \/>\n$p = -\\frac{1}{2}, -\\frac{1}{3}$<\/p>\n<p>$20q^2+9q+1 = 0$<br \/>\n$(4q+1)(5q+1) = 0$<br \/>\n$q = -\\frac{1}{4}, -\\frac{1}{5}$<\/p>\n<p>$p &lt; q$<\/p>\n<p><strong>2)\u00a0Answer\u00a0(A)<\/strong><\/p>\n<p>$3p^2+2p-1 = 0$<br \/>\n$(3p-1)(p+1) = 0$<br \/>\n$p = -1, \\frac{1}{3}$<\/p>\n<p>$2q^2+7q+6 = 0$<br \/>\n$(2q+3)(q+2) = 0$<br \/>\n$q = -2, -\\frac{3}{2}$<\/p>\n<p>p &gt; q<\/p>\n<p><strong>3)\u00a0Answer\u00a0(D)<\/strong><\/p>\n<p>$3p^2+15p+18 = 0$<br \/>\n$p^2+5p+6 = 0$<br \/>\n$(p+2)(p+3) = 0$<br \/>\n$p = -3, -2$<\/p>\n<p>$q^2+7q+12 = 0$<br \/>\n$(q+4)(q+3) = 0$<br \/>\n$q = -4, -3$<\/p>\n<p>$p\\geq q$<\/p>\n<p><strong>4)\u00a0Answer\u00a0(C)<\/strong><\/p>\n<p>$p = \\frac{\\sqrt{4}}{\\sqrt{9}}$<br \/>\n$p = \\frac{2}{3}$<\/p>\n<p>$9q^2-12q+4 = 0$<br \/>\n${(3q-2)}^2 = 0$<br \/>\n$q = \\frac{2}{3}$<\/p>\n<p>p = q<\/p>\n<p><strong>5)\u00a0Answer\u00a0(E)<\/strong><\/p>\n<p>$p^2+13p+42 = 0$<br \/>\n$(p+6)(p+7) = 0$<br \/>\n$p = -6, -7$<\/p>\n<p>$q^2 = 36$<br \/>\n$q = -6, 6$<\/p>\n<p>$p\\leq q$<\/p>\n<p><strong>6)\u00a0Answer\u00a0(C)<\/strong><\/p>\n<p>$2x^2+19x+45 = 0$<br \/>\n$(2x+9)(x+5) = 0$<br \/>\n$x = -5, -\\frac{9}{2}$<\/p>\n<p>$2y^2+11y+12 = 0$<br \/>\n$(2y+3)(y+4) = 0$<br \/>\n$y = -4, -\\frac{3}{2}$<\/p>\n<p>x &lt; y<\/p>\n<p><strong>7)\u00a0Answer\u00a0(C)<\/strong><\/p>\n<p>$3x^2-13x+12 = 0$<br \/>\n$(3x-4)(x-3) = 0$<br \/>\n$x = \\frac{4}{3}, 3$<\/p>\n<p>$2y^2-15y+28 = 0$<br \/>\n$(2y-7)(y-4) = 0$<br \/>\n$y = \\frac{7}{2}, 4$<\/p>\n<p>x &lt; y<\/p>\n<p><strong>8)\u00a0Answer\u00a0(E)<\/strong><\/p>\n<p>$x^2 = 16$<br \/>\n$x = 4, -4$<\/p>\n<p>$2y^2-17y+36 = 0$<br \/>\n$(2y-9)(y-4) = 0$<br \/>\n$y = \\frac{9}{2}, 4$<\/p>\n<p>$x \\leq y$<\/p>\n<p><strong>9)\u00a0Answer\u00a0(D)<\/strong><\/p>\n<p>$6x^2+19x+15 = 0$<br \/>\n$(3x+5)(2x+3) = 0$<br \/>\n$x = -\\frac{5}{3}, -\\frac{3}{2}$<\/p>\n<p>$3y^2+11y+10 = 0$<br \/>\n$(3y+5)(y+2) = 0$<br \/>\n$y = -\\frac{5}{3}, -2$<\/p>\n<p>$x\\geq y$<\/p>\n<p><strong>10)\u00a0Answer\u00a0(D)<\/strong><\/p>\n<p>$2x^2-11x+15 = 0$<br \/>\n$(2x-5)(x-3) = 0$<br \/>\n$x = 3, \\frac{5}{2}$<\/p>\n<p>$2y^2-11y+14 = 0$<br \/>\n$(2y-7)(y-2) = 0$<br \/>\n$y = 2, \\frac{7}{2}$<\/p>\n<p>relationship between x and y cannot be established<\/p>\n<p><strong>11)\u00a0Answer\u00a0(E)<\/strong><\/p>\n<p>$x^2+x-12 = 0$<br \/>\n$(x-3)(x+4) = 0$<br \/>\n$x = -4, 3$<\/p>\n<p>$y^2+2y-8 = 0$<br \/>\n$(y-2)(y+4) = 0$<br \/>\n$y = -4, 2$<\/p>\n<p>Hence, a relationship can not be established between $x$ and $y$<\/p>\n<p><strong>12)\u00a0Answer\u00a0(E)<\/strong><\/p>\n<p>$4x^2-13x+9 = 0$<br \/>\n$(4x-9)(x-1) = 0$<br \/>\n$x = 1, \\frac{9}{4}$<\/p>\n<p>$3y^2-14y+16 = 0$<br \/>\n$(3y-8)(y-2) = 0$<br \/>\n$y = 2, \\frac{8}{3}$<\/p>\n<p>relationship between x and y cannot be established<\/p>\n<p><strong>13)\u00a0Answer\u00a0(A)<\/strong><\/p>\n<p>$8x^2+18x+9 = 0$<br \/>\n$(4x+3)(2x+3) = 0$<br \/>\n$x = -\\frac{3}{2}, -\\frac{3}{4}$<\/p>\n<p>$4y^2+19y+21 = 0$<br \/>\n$(4y+7)(y+3) = 0$<br \/>\n$y = -3, -\\frac{7}{4}$<\/p>\n<p>x &gt; y<\/p>\n<p><strong>14)\u00a0Answer\u00a0(C)<\/strong><\/p>\n<p>$3x^2+16x+21 = 0$<br \/>\n$(3x+7)(x+3) = 0$<br \/>\n$x = -3, -\\frac{7}{3}$<\/p>\n<p>$6y^2+17y+12 = 0$<br \/>\n$(3y+4)(2y+3) = 0$<br \/>\n$y = -\\frac{4}{3}, -\\frac{3}{2}$<\/p>\n<p>x &lt; y<\/p>\n<p><strong>15)\u00a0Answer\u00a0(E)<\/strong><\/p>\n<p>$x^2 = 49$<br \/>\n$x = -7, 7$<\/p>\n<p>$y^2-4y-21 = 0$<br \/>\n$(y-7)(y+3) = 0$<br \/>\n$y = -3, 7$<\/p>\n<p>Hence, pairs of (x,y) are (-7,-3), (-7,7), (7,-3) and (7,7). Hence, in some x is less than y and in some x is greater than y. Thus no relation can be established.<\/p>\n<p class=\"text-center\"><a href=\"https:\/\/cracku.in\/pay\/7f6ir\" target=\"_blank\" class=\"btn btn-info \">105 SBI Clerk mocks for Rs. 199.
